"I actually think people will be astonished that next gen launch titles from other companies might not be much different from Crysis 3."
On his company's own efforts for new hardware, Yerli added: "Crytek's projects generally will be way above what we've achieved on the existing consoles."
Yerli also praised the work his team has done creating what he believes is a unique game world.
"Crysis 3 has its own visual identity, [the urban rainforest] is a world that hasn't been done before, that kind of depiction, the quality and level of immersion. I think no game has ever done that kind of setting, it's a visual spectacle.
"It has not even been done in Hollywood. People might suggest there are similarities with I Am Legend, but that is quite different to this. I Am Legend is overgrown, but Crysis 3's urban rainforest is a whole different level of that. It has its own identity and I'm very proud of what the team achieved in this regard."
